July 29, 200817 yr Hi,After reinstalling everything the other night, I tried to get my simconnect working again. I must be missing some small entry somewhere. After reading the forum and following everything, double checking everything, I get this error coming up in ASX "Problem writing weather values: The network path was not found.(Error) Source = "I've run the traffic test and it says I'm connected to FSX. ASX seems to work ok up until the point where it tries writing the data to FSX.I've attatched my Xengine Log file. Also, here is what I have my Simconnect file setup like, which resides in My Documents on the Client machine running ASX. The address is from the FSX machine:[simConnect]Protocol=IPv4Address=XXXXXXXXXXPort=500MaxReceiveSize=4096DisableNagle=0..and here is my XML file, which resides on the FSX machine in C:Documents and Settings[username]Application DataMicrosoftFSX :<?xml version="1.0" encoding="Windows-1252"?>SimConnect Server ConfigurationSimConnect.xmlFalseTruePipeglobal64REPLACE_WITH_PORT_NAMETrueIPv6global64 :: REPLACE_WITH_PORT_NUMBERFalseIPv4global64XXXXXXXXXX 500TruePipelocal64REPLACE_WITH_PORT_NAMETrueIPv6local64::1 REPLACE_WITH_PORT_NUMBERFalseIPv4local64XXXXXXXXXX 500Thanks for the help, Regards, Ron Gautreau CYYZ
July 29, 200817 yr Author An update....I decided to examine the log a little closer last night and discovered what the problem was.What was happening was that ASX was looking for the name of my old FSX machine in the registry. When I corrected this with the name of the new machine, all was working perfectly.Thanks anyway, Regards, Ron Gautreau CYYZ
